Job Summary | The Rowley Lab (www.plateletlab.com ) is seeking two highly motivated and skilled Postdoctoral Scientist to join their team within the platelet and thrombo-inflammation group at the University of Utah. The candidates will research how mitochondria, genetics and genomics influence platelet function, bleeding, and clot formation. One project will investigate the mechanisms regulating mitochondrial fission in megakaryocytes, and will use mouse models to determine how mitochondrial fission affects platelet production and function. The other project involves developing and implementing cutting-edge CRISPR/Cas9 approaches in primary human hematopoietic progenitors to evaluate gene functions and the effect of genetic variants in blood cells, including platelets and megakaryocytes. This will include designing and conducting high throughput functional assays and pooled library screens followed by validation of findings in cell culture and mouse models. The successful candidates will have the opportunity to prepare themselves for academic or industry success through presentations, publications, grant writing, and exposure to a diverse range of scientific techniques and collaboration opportunities. |
Responsibilities | Investigate mitochondrial morphology and function in gene edited human and mouse megakaryocytes and platelets. Design and perform assays platelet function assays (flow cytometry, aggregation, in vivo clot models) Design and execute CRISPR/Cas9-based experiments in primary human blood cells to evaluate gene functions and genetic variants in blood cells Develop, optimize, and analyze high throughput functional assays and pooled library screens Help with the validation of candidate variants and genes in mouse models Analyze data using relevant software and present findings in internal and external meetings Contribute to scientific publications and grant proposals Collaborate with other members of the team and assist with training lab members Maintain detailed laboratory notebooks and ensure compliance with laboratory safety guidelines Present at relevant scientific conferences and meetings to stay current with the field. |
